Cleaning
WARNING:
• Unplug the charger before cleaning the
housing with a soft cloth.
• Remove the battery pack before cleaning
your power tool.
• Keep the ventilation slots clear and
regularly clean the housing with a soft
cloth.
Optional Accessories
WARNING: Since accessories, other
than those offered by DeWalt, have not
been tested with this product, use of
such accessories with this tool could be
hazardous. To reduce the risk of injury, only
DeWalt, recommended accessories should
be used with this product.
Consult your dealer for further information on the
appropriate accessories.

Protecting the Environment

Separate collection. This product must
not be disposed of with normal
household waste.
Should you fi nd one day that your D
needs replacement, or if it is of no further use to you,
do not dispose of it with household waste. Make this
product available for separate collection.
Separate collection of used products and
packaging allows materials to be
recycled and used again. Re-use of
recycled materials helps prevent
environmental pollution and reduces the
demand for raw materials.
Local regulations may provide for separate collection
of electrical products from the household, at
municipal waste sites or by the retailer when you
purchase a new product.

Battery Pack
The long life battery pack must be recharged when it
fails to produce suffi cient power on jobs which were
easily done before. At the end of its technical life,
discard it with due care for our environment:
• Run the battery pack down completely, then
remove it from the tool.
• Li-Ion cells are recyclable. Take them to your
dealer or a local recycling station. The collected
battery packs will be recycled or disposed of
properly.
